28 /* Determine whether `gregset_t' contains register REGNUM.  */
29 
30 static int
sparc64_gregset_supplies_p(int regnum)31 sparc64_gregset_supplies_p (int regnum)
32 {
33   if (gdbarch_ptr_bit (current_gdbarch) == 32)
34     return sparc32_gregset_supplies_p (regnum);
35 
36   /* Integer registers.  */
37   if ((regnum >= SPARC_G1_REGNUM && regnum <= SPARC_G7_REGNUM)
38       || (regnum >= SPARC_O0_REGNUM && regnum <= SPARC_O7_REGNUM)
39       || (regnum >= SPARC_L0_REGNUM && regnum <= SPARC_L7_REGNUM)
40       || (regnum >= SPARC_I0_REGNUM && regnum <= SPARC_I7_REGNUM))
41     return 1;
42 
43   /* Control registers.  */
44   if (regnum == SPARC64_PC_REGNUM
45       || regnum == SPARC64_NPC_REGNUM
46       || regnum == SPARC64_STATE_REGNUM
47       || regnum == SPARC64_Y_REGNUM
48       || regnum == SPARC64_FPRS_REGNUM)
49     return 1;
50 
51   return 0;
52 }
53 
54 /* Determine whether `fpregset_t' contains register REGNUM.  */
55 
56 static int
sparc64_fpregset_supplies_p(int regnum)57 sparc64_fpregset_supplies_p (int regnum)
58 {
59   if (gdbarch_ptr_bit (current_gdbarch) == 32)
60     return sparc32_fpregset_supplies_p (regnum);
61 
62   /* Floating-point registers.  */
63   if ((regnum >= SPARC_F0_REGNUM && regnum <= SPARC_F31_REGNUM)
64       || (regnum >= SPARC64_F32_REGNUM && regnum <= SPARC64_F62_REGNUM))
65     return 1;
66 
67   /* Control registers.  */
68   if (regnum == SPARC64_FSR_REGNUM)
69     return 1;
70 
71   return 0;
72 }
